1
0
mirror of https://github.com/bitwarden/server synced 2026-01-06 18:43:36 +00:00
Files
server/src/Sql/dbo/Stored Procedures/User_ReadPublicKeysByProviderUserIds.sql
2021-07-15 16:37:27 +02:00

21 lines
496 B
Transact-SQL

CREATE PROCEDURE [dbo].[User_ReadPublicKeysByProviderUserIds]
@ProviderId UNIQUEIDENTIFIER,
@ProviderUserIds [dbo].[GuidIdArray] READONLY
AS
BEGIN
SET NOCOUNT ON
SELECT
PU.[Id],
PU.[UserId],
U.[PublicKey]
FROM
@ProviderUserIds PUIDs
INNER JOIN
[dbo].[ProviderUser] PU ON PUIDs.Id = PU.Id AND PU.[Status] = 1 -- Accepted
INNER JOIN
[dbo].[User] U ON PU.UserId = U.Id
WHERE
PU.ProviderId = @ProviderId
END